Q: Is 101,001,310 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 101,001,310 is a composite number.

Why is 101,001,310 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 101,001,310 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 10,100,131 20,200,262 50,500,655 and 101,001,310, with no remainder.

Since 101,001,310 cannot be divided by just 1 and 101,001,310, it is a composite number.
